uPVC windows may have issues opening or locking. This problem usually occurs when the locking mechanism is stiff or jammed. If this is the case, a quick solution is to use graphite powder or machine oil to make sure that the lock's handle is lubricated and the lock mechanism. This will allow the mechanism to free up and UPVC Window Repairs Near Me allow the window or door to operate normal again.

Another issue that is often encountered with uPVC windows is that the hinges can become stiff or stuck. This issue is typically caused by grit and dust that build up on the hinges over time. Lubricating the hinges using oil or grease is the solution. Using the wrong type of grease, however, could lead to damage and may render the hinges inoperable.

Stained Glass Repairs

Stained glass windows are stunning features in homes, churches and other buildings. They add visual interest as well as privacy and light to an area. However, they are quite fragile and need to be carefully maintained to ensure they remain in good condition. Even with the best maintenance, stained and leaded glass windows can deteriorate as they age due to aging and exposure to the elements and weather elements. This leads to a number of issues, including cracks, fading, and water leakage. It is important to locate an expert local to restore your stained or leaded window back to its original beauty.

The average cost to repair broken or cracked stained glass is $500. The exact price will depend on the kind of solution needed to solve the problem. For instance professional technicians may use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to repair the broken glass. They may also re-lead the lead cames, and then reseal the stained glass. There are a variety of options each with their own pros and cons. The selection of the most suitable solution will be determined by the size of the crack, the location and the kind of material used in the production of the glass.

Leaded glass cracks may be caused by vibration, thermal expansion and contraction, building movement or just normal wear and tear. The cracks may grow and create larger problems as time passes. To avoid further damage and expansion the crack that is located across the face of stained-glass panels or their face must be fixed as fast as possible. In the past, this was accomplished by splicing an "Dutchman's" lead flange onto the crack. This method was not a great solution, and today there are better ways to repair these kinds of c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a specific art that can take many forms. It can be as easy as repairing a crack, or as complicated as making a stained glass door panel or window to its original condition. Generally speaking, the price of a restoration project is considerably more than that of an easy repair or replacement. The job involves cleaning and getting rid of damaged glass, securing lead cames, resealing cement and re-tying it and reinstalling st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ping blocks air and water from entering homes through the gaps surrounding doors and windows. It's an essential element of home maintenance and can reduce the need for costly repairs or energy bills, as in making homes more comfortable. The materials used in the construction of this seal can deteriorate with time, as a result of wear and tear. It is crucial to replace these materials regularly.

You can determine the weather stripping is been damaged by noticing a damp spot after washing your windows, a whistling sound when driving down the road or a draft you feel when you are in front of the door that is closed. These are all good indicators that you should find a Tasker in my area who can repair your weatherstripping.

Taskers can use a variety of weatherstripping materials to seal your doors and windows. Foam tapes are composed of open-cell or closed cell foam. They are available in a variety of dimensions, widths, and thicknesses. These are easy to install and cut with scissors. Felt strips are inexpensive and last for at least a year. You can cut them to size using scissors, and then att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ding window using glue, staples or tacks. Metal V strips or vinyl are a bit more difficult to put in, but they can be nailed along the window jamb.
